| 1:13.1 | really appreciate you. We have such a good episode for you today. Jess van der Veer is the founder |
| 1:19.3 | of Nurtured First, formerly our Mama Village, which you might know from her Instagram. So Jess is a |
| 1:26.5 | registered psychotherapist and a mum of three. |
| 1:29.4 | And in this episode, she shares with us how hard she found it going from two to three children. |
| 1:36.7 | But this episode is really about how to cope when you're not coping. And I know that all of us will have had moments when we are |
| 1:46.2 | not coping. And that is the gift that this episode gives you. Jess shares so many ideas |
| 1:52.5 | from her personal life and her professional life about what to do when we just feel overwhelmed. |
